课程介绍

The BOSS summer course gives students aged 8–17 a total of 20 hours of tuition per week: 15 hours of English and 5 hours of leadership training. Every student prepares for the Trinity College London GESE spoken English exam and the Leadership Skills Foundation Young Leader Award, both included in the fee. Maximum class size is 16.

包含内容

One weekly price of £1,350 covers tuition, exams and awards, full-board accommodation, two full-day and two half-day excursions per week with all entrance fees, the daily activity programme, weekly laundry and the BOSS welcome pack (t-shirt, diary, bucket hat and wristband). Minimum stay 2 weeks.

住宿

Comfortable boarding houses on the Buckswood School campus with 24/7 supervision and houseparents. Boys and girls stay in separate blocks; most rooms have 2 beds, with some singles and larger rooms for younger children. Roommates are matched by age and mixed by nationality.

餐食方案

Full board with freshly prepared meals daily, including healthy, vegetarian and vegan options and alternatives for allergies and dietary needs.

活动与 экскурсии

Afternoons feature sports and creative activities; evenings bring discos, talent shows and team games. Four excursions every week (two full-day, two half-day) to UK destinations, with all museum and attraction entrance fees included. New for 2026: the “50 Things to Do at BOSS” challenge.

设施

A safe UK boarding-school campus in East Sussex near Hastings, with sports fields, dining hall, games areas, boarding houses and Wi-Fi in common areas and houses.

更多关于此营地

BOSS Summer School is a residential international summer school held on the Buckswood School campus near Hastings, in East Sussex, southern England. It accepts students aged 8 to 17 and runs as a single residential programme rather than a set of separate courses. Programme and activities. Students take 15 hours of English lessons per week, combined with a leadership strand that runs alongside the language teaching. Afternoons and evenings are given over to an activity programme using the facilities on the Buckswood site, which include sports fields, dining hall and games areas. Accommodation, meals and supervision. Students are accommodated in boarding houses on the Buckswood School campus. Supervision is provided around the clock by houseparents, and boys and girls are accommodated separately. Meals are included in the residential package. Ages, dates and duration. The programme accepts students aged 8 to 17. Bookings are made in blocks of two or three weeks, and the published price is GBP 1,350 per week. The camp runs within a summer window ending in mid-August; the arrival dates currently open are listed in the session block on this page. Parents should confirm the final date and price for a specific arrival with the provider before arranging flights. Location and travel. The Buckswood campus sits in the East Sussex countryside near Hastings, on England's south coast, within reach of London's airports. Transfer arrangements are not published as part of the standard package and should be confirmed directly. Who the programme may suit. BOSS may suit families who want more from a summer course than language practice alone — the leadership component is a stated part of the programme rather than an optional extra. The wide 8-17 band and the enclosed campus setting may also suit a first residential experience for a younger child, provided parents are satisfied with the supervision arrangements, which they should discuss with the school directly.
